Entertainment Among the myriad challenges faced by sports leagues and their stakeholders in connection with the coronavirus (COVID-19) pandemic, questions concerning the payment of player salaries during suspended, and perhaps lost, seasons have garnered much media attention. This issue continues to be addressed in professional sports leagues around the world, and is dependent upon a number of factors including the legal system in which the league operates and the league’s economic system, which may involve regulatory oversight by national and/or governing bodies (e.g., FIFA, UEFA) and/or a collective bargaining agreement (CBA) between management and players (e.g., MLB, NBA, NFL).
